Two-dimensional kinematics in gait evaluation of Bardigiano Horse breeding stock

Abstract

Kinematics studies the change of position of the body segments in space during a specified time: motion is described quantitatively by linear and angular variables. The data are displayed graphically. In this preliminary study the kinematics parameters at trot of an Italian horse breed are considered, in order to develop an objective method for gait analysis in field condition. Six Bardigiano mares were considered. Fourteen markers were glued on the left side of the standing mares at previously defined skeletal reference points. The recordings were made using a video digital camera and analyzed using the SIMI Motion System. The obtained joint angle-time diagrams are similar to those found by other authors in other breeds. A horse showed an elbow motion diagram quite different from the others. The data were compared with judges scores. This study is a first step to obtain a reliable method for gait evaluation in this breed.
